A washing machine leaking oil into the drum is caused by a torn drum seal or by a stuck object breaking the gasket seal at the rear of the drum Learn how to identify why your washing machine is leaking and correct it. Tub seals may be corroded and difficult to move, but can be replaced

Oil underneath the washing machine is normally caused by a faulty transmission system which is normally uneconomical to repair. A leaky washing machine is frustrating and can cause further damage at home Learn how to easily fix a washing machine that is leaking transmission fluid/oil

You need to determine where the oil is leaking from It could be the input shaft seal, the cover gasket or the seals at the spin pinion gear that protrudes out the top of the gearcase If it’s a small amount of oil, i wouldn’t worry about adding more back in.
